Fisheries of the South Atlantic, Gulf of Mexico, and Caribbean; 
Southeast Data, Assessment, and Review (SEDAR) Public Meeting

AGENCY: National Marine Fisheries Service (NMFS), National Oceanic and 
Atmospheric Administration (NOAA), Commerce.

ACTION: Notice of public meeting of the SEDAR Steering Committee.

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

SUMMARY: The SEDAR Steering Committee will meet to discuss the SEDAR 
process and assessment schedule. See S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ION.

DATES: The SEDAR Steering Committee will meet Tuesday, September 26, 
2017, from 1 p.m. until 6 p.m. and Wednesday, September 27, 2017, from 
8:30 a.m. until 1 p.m.

ADDRESSES: 
    Meeting address: The Steering Committee meeting will be held at the 
Crowne Plaza Charleston Airport, 4831 Tanger Outlet Boulevard, North 
Charleston, SC 29418, 2008 Savannah Highway, Charleston, SC 29407; 
telephone: (843) 744-4422.
    SEDAR address: South Atlantic Fishery Management Council, 4055 
Faber Place Drive, Suite 201, N. Charleston, SC 29405. 
www.sedarweb.org.

F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T: John Carmichael, Deputy Executive 
Director, 4055 Faber Place Drive, Suite 201, North Charleston, SC 
29405; phone: (843) 571-4366 or toll free 866/SAFMC-10; fax: (843) 769-
4520; email: [email protected].

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: The items of discussion are as follows:

1. Research Track Process
2. SEDAR Current Projects Update
3. SEDAR Future Projects Schedule
4. Budget Report

    Although non-emergency issues not contained in this agenda may come 
before this group for discussion, those issues may not be the subject 
of formal action during this meeting. Action will be restricted to 
those issues specifically identified in this notice and any issues 
arising after publication of this notice that require emergency action 
under section 305(c) of the Magnuson-Stevens Fishery Conservation and 
Management Act, provided the public has been notified of the intent to 
take final action to address the emergency.

Special Accommodations

    This meeting is accessible to people with disabilities. Requests 
for auxiliary aids should be directed to the SAFMC office (see 
ADDRESSES) at least 5 business days prior to the meeting.

    Note: The times and sequence specified in this agenda are 
subject to change.


    Authority: 16 U.S.C. 1801 et seq.
